For any mountaineers-armchair or otherwise-current edition of the Bulletin
of the American Meteorological Society
has an interesting read-
Weather And Death On Mount Everest: An Analysis Of The Into Thin Air Storm.
G. W. K. Moore and John L. Semple, pages 465-480.
